Elton John and Billy Joel performed in Chicago on April 12, 2003
Monday, April 14 2003

Fan report by Brendan.

I arrived at the Allstate Arena about a half of an hour early, and even then you could feel the excitement build. At 7:40 pm the lights went down and the overture from "Aida" hit, followed immedeatly by the theme from "The Natural".

"Yankeed Doodle" began and Billy joel entered wearing his customary solid black ensamble. Elton then entered wearing and blue suit with what appeared to be musical notes on the forearms. They did all three duets without a word.

Billy then left the stage and Elton took on a range of favorites. It is a shame, however, because the crowd was not at all enthusiastic about "The Wasteland" or "I Want Love" but their energy came back during "Rocket man" which was one of the highlights of the evening.

He fifnished with "Saturday Night's Alright", and "Crocodile Rock" and thanked us for being such a good audience.

Then something happened that really surprised me...there was a ten minute intermission. I thought they had stopped the intermissions (Billy later explained that there were technical problems they had to take care of). After the 10 minutes the lights went down and Billy opened with "Scenes from an Italian Restaurant." He then sang "My kind of Town" The Frank Sinatra ode to Chicago. He went on with his show, until he found an Elvis impersonator in the crowd, and sand "All Shook up" in honor of him.

The duets towards the end of the show were by far the best. Someone had thrown a bra on the stage, and of course, Elton put it on, and asked Billy if he thought it fit. During "You Maybe Right" Elton was shining Billy's head with a tulip.

Billy then did a piano version of "Chicago (That toddeling Town)". And they ended with "Piano Man". I had seen a F2F tour before, but this one was much better. Following is the complete set list of the Chicago show on April 12, 2003:


    Elton John & Billy Joel

  • Your Song
  • Just The Way You Are
  • Don't Let The Sun Go Down On Me

    Elton John & band

  • Funeral For A Friend/Love Lies Bleeding
  • Someone Saved My Life Tonight
  • Philadelphia Freedom
  • The Wasteland
  • I Want Love
  • Rocket Man
  • I Guess That's Why They Call It The Blues
  • Take Me To The Pilot
  • Tiny Dancer
  • Saturday Night's Alright (For Fighting)
  • Crocodile Rock

    Billy Joel & band

  • Scenes From An Italian Restaurant
  • My Kind Of Town
  • Movin' Out (Anthony's Song)
  • Prelude/Angry Young Man
  • Allentown
  • All Shock Up
  • An Innocent Man
  • I Go To Extremes
  • The River Of Dreams
  • Sweet Home Chicago
  • New York State Of Mind
  • It's Still Rock And Roll To Me
  • Only The Good Die Young

    Elton John & Billy Joel

  • My Life
  • The Bitch Is Back
  • You May Be Right
  • Bennie And The Jets
  • Chicago
  • A Hard Day's Night
  • Great Balls Of Fire
  • Piano Man
